Output 8fe61c771fa453ec5782680ee4065e67cd0f9d639319ff83dbfea35ec505d5b3:0

value
2002897
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f28c3833057bfdb7909b5ea15357d2c9c5977541 OP_EQUALVERIFY OP_CHECKSIG
address
1P7UW3hmqHuA3kLFMTUpwa3SSQoNY68e4a
transaction
8fe61c771fa453ec5782680ee4065e67cd0f9d639319ff83dbfea35ec505d5b3
spent
true